Installation Requirements
A minimum 2"
 (51)
 is required from the bottom of the 
cooktop to combustible materials.
Clearance is required for the conduit located at the right rear 
of induction and electric cooktops. Refer to the illustration 
below for dimensions.
Refer to the illustrations on pages 6–8 for additional 
minimum clearances. Installation dimensions are the same 
for induction and electric cooktops of the same width.
 WARNING
Failure to locate the cooktop without proper clearances 
will result in a fire hazard.

FLUSH INSTALLATION
Contemporary induction and electric cooktops can be 
mounted flush with the top of the countertop, or as a frame-
less standard installation sitting on top of the countertop 
surface. If the cooktop is to be mounted flush with the coun-
tertop, a recessed area surrounding the cooktop cut-out 
must be provided. Wolf downdraft systems cannot be used 
with contemporary induction and electric cooktops.
An installation kit and instructions required for a flush 
installation are provided with the contemporary cooktop.
 CAUTION
Flush installation is intended for granite, solid surface 
or stone countertop surfaces only.
MULTIPLE COOKTOPS
When multiple cooktops or modules are installed side by 
side, the countertop cut-out width is determined by adding 
the width of each unit, then subtracting 1"
 (25)
. Refer to the 
illustration below.
IMPORTANT NOTE:
 Contemporary induction and electric 
cooktops are not designed to be installed in combination 
with other cooktops.
